2012-09-20 23 views
0

我目前正在與一些合作伙伴開發軟件。我們使用Codeblocks來管理這個項目,而且很可能會使用SVN作爲版本控制工具。C :: B Projet,非必需文件SVN

但是,由於我已經使用SVN處理乳膠報告,我知道一些文件是完全不必要的。

因此,我的問題有點寬泛。您如何看待我們應該繼續使用SVN存儲庫?

我們應該把C :: B項目目錄直接放在SVN倉庫裏面嗎? (我認爲我們會遇到項目選項的一些問題,因爲這個庫並不適用於所有人) 我們是否應該只將源文件放在目錄中,並將源文件「鏈接」到SVN之外的代碼塊項目儲存庫?此解決方案可能允許其他IDE與相同的源文件一起使用,對不對?

最好的問候,

Al_th

回答

0

我覺得你不應該堅持一個IDE。更好的解決方案是創建像Makefile或Cmake這樣的通用構建系統。使用MakeFile,您可以輕鬆地將項目導入到所有體面的IDE中(其中更多甚至支持從遠程存儲庫下載項目)

使用通用編譯系統,您可以將它用於您自己喜歡的IDE甚至編譯器。

我也會考慮把C :: B改成kdevelop,它完全被SVN/GIT/Cmake/Make所支持。還有對C++ 11x的支持。

是不是更相關程序員比c + + stackoverflow?

相關問題